Astro-logical Forecast for Wednesday 7/15/2015: New Moon in Cancer

Dead Moon or not, the early part of today looks busy — especially in the wee hours while you were sleeping. First the sensitive Cancer Moon met up with Mercury and Mars – then opposed Pluto at 4:10AM ET. A need for emotional security is given the potential for expressive communication and action, followed by a catharsis or power play. How wild  and intense were your dreams?

At 10:08AM ET Mars (action) is opposed by Pluto (underground, underworld), suggesting more than the average amount of force and persuasion. At 7:38PM ET mental Mercury takes no prisoners when it is also opposed by Pluto. An empowered perspective or a verbal lashing may be yours, especially if you have a planet or angle around 14 degrees (halfway through) Aries, Libra, Capricorn and Cancer.

In between that turbulent threesome, more revelations and/or disruptions may pop up, as the Moon is challenged by rebel Uranus. So much action…and we don’t even get to today’s main event — the New Moon — until 9:24PM ET. Finally you can light a candle, make a list and set your intentions for the next lunar cycle!

The Moon functions well in Cancer, the sign it rules. Here it seeks to fulfill a need for emotional/homeland security Y’know, core foundational concerns. Are you standing on solid ground? Where is your home? Tell me about your family, your mother, your ancestors. How are you being nourished and nurtured? How are you nurturing others?

We are challenged this month to think deeply about these core foundation concerns.  Don’t like what you’re standing on — or standing for? Sending the wrong message, are you? Then use the penetrating perspective and force of this particular New Moon to change it.

The Sabian Symbol for the New Moon at 24 Cancer seems daunting at first: “a woman and two men on a bit of sunlit land facing south.”  Huh? Thank goodness Blain Bovee wrote a book to help us figure it out: “This is an image of a classic love triangle, the challenge of choosing personal affinities born of the heart“.

Again with the hearts. Must be reflective of Jupiter and Venus nearing the end of Leo, that great-hearted sign.

Bovee suggests that a choice between two perhaps worthy but different options must be made. Consider that Arthur Brooks used to be a “liberal bohemian musician”. What was sacrificed in order for him to be where he is right now?

Bovee suggests we apply this Sabian Symbol with a mind to “the challenge of choosing one’s path in life; finding oneself in triangulated situations; feeling confined in the world; confinement as spiritual freedom; toying with the hearts of others; withholding one’s favor”. And also this: “finding that even the love of God involves a third party”. That one is deep. Have to think about it. Astro-logical Forecast for Wednesday 6/26/2013: Mercury Retrograde; Ain’t it Grand?

This should be interesting. Moon in unconventional Aquarius goes void of course at 9:08AM ET, on a smooth connection from Mars in glib, multi-tasking Gemini, where it can excel at killing two birds with one stone. At that same moment, mental Mercury, planet of mindset, communication, travel and electronic gizmos, goes retrograde at 24 Cancer, possibly screwing up said communications whilst giving us a chance to review whatever plans we’ve thought out since the last retrograde in February. And yet…

…the other pattern of note today is a Grand Water Trine among stern Saturn in nitty-gritty Scorpio, empathic, dreamy Neptune in soulful Pisces and fueled by the Sun in home-and-family Cancer. This is a powerful pattern that facilitates solid structures based on genuine insight and compassion, which leaves me cautiously optimistic that the two decisions on marriage equality we are expecting from the Supreme Court will declare DOMA unconstitutional and leave California’s currently-dead Prop. 8 on a slab in the morgue…even though it may allow states to decide what level of  consciousness– evolved or unevolved —  they would like their laws to reflect. Here is helpful legal analysis of the two cases that are being decided today. My sense of caution is because of the Moon being void of course, a condition often reflected by upsets, surprise twists and victories in favor of the underdog, but also actions that end up being of no consequence. In your own personal world, you’ll be more impacted by the stabilizing energy of the Grand Water Trine if you have a planet or angle around 4-5 degrees of any sign.

The Sabian Symbol for Mercury retrograde at 24 Cancer seems daunting at first: “a woman and two men on a bit of sunlit land facing south.”  Huh? Thank goodness Blain Bovee wrote a book to help us figure this out. This is an image of a classic love triangle, suggesting that a choice between two perhaps worthy but different options must be made. The “sunlit land” is the issue highlighted that must be decided.
